About Mibora minima (L.) Desv.

Mibora minima (L.) Desv. is a small annual grass species. It grows in tufts of thin stems that are approximately 0.3 mm wide and 10 cm long. Each stem bears 2 or 3 leaves located at or very near its base. The leaves have tender, shallowly grooved sheaths that are rounded on the back, with ligules measuring 0.2–1 mm long. Their leaf blades are either flat or enrolled, 1–5 cm long, up to 0.5 mm wide, and end in a stump tip.
